Shaksgam Valley
Shaksgam Valley

❖ India has lodged a strong complaint with China over construction work in the Shaksgam valley.

❖ It is described as an "illegal" effort to change the situation on the ground.

❖ Shaksgam valley is a strategically situated region which is now part of Pakistanoccupied Kashmir (PoK).

❖ The Shaksgam valley, or the Trans Karakoram Tract, is part of the Hunza-Gilgit Region of PoK.

❖ It is bordered by the Xinjiang Province of the People's Republic of China to the north.

❖ The northern areas of PoK are to its west and south and the Siachen Glacier region to the east.

❖ In 1963, Pakistan ceded the Shaksgam valley to China when it signed a border agreement with Beijing to settle their border disputes.

❖ India had never accepted the China-Pakistan border agreement of 1963, under which Pakistan tried to illegally cede this area to China.
